There’s been a lot of drama recently surrounding Britney Spears and her kids. Last month, it was reported her kids, Preston and Jayden, did not want to see her. Their father, Kevin Federline, released videos showing Spears arguing with both kids, trying to paint her as semi abusive, although the videos didn’t really show that.
And now recently, Jayden (15) sat down with filmmaker Daphne Barak for a new interview about his feelings toward his mother.
He claims he feels bad for his brother because Britney hasn’t treated him fairly.
I think Mom has struggled giving us both attention and showing us equal love and I don’t think she showed enough to Preston and I feel really bad for that. We’ve both been through so much pressure in the past that this is our safe place now, to process all the emotional trauma we’ve been through to heal, heal our mental state.
So it looks Jayden is still not ready to see his mother, hinting that his father’s estate is their safe place. They reportedly haven’t seen Britney in months. Jayden claims he’ll be ready to see his mother again one day.
It’s just going to take a lot of time and effort. I just want her to get better mentally. When she gets better, I really want to see her again.
How is Britney taking this news? Well, she posted a pretty lengthy statement to her Instagram account late Thursday night.
It deeply saddens me to know [Jayden’s] outcry of saying I wasn’t up to his expectations of a mother … and maybe one day we can meet face to face and talk about this openly !!!!
